The Ministry of SaskBuilds and Procurement, North Property Management requires a Building Operator for duties in Saskatoon . As a member of a service-oriented team, you will be responsible for providing customer comfort and service by ensuring a safe environment for our customers and clients.

The successful candidate will respond to client inquiries and ensure facilities and equipment are safe and in good operating readiness. You will also perform routine maintenance and custodial duties, including all minor maintenance, as well as operate/maintain manual and heavy-duty powered grounds equipment; climb ladders, lift and/or carry heavy objects. You will perform security procedures, maintain stock and supplies, and ensure facility and equipment is safe and meets operating standards. You will also be responsible for the supervision of other Ministry staff in the building.

The successful candidate will have the ability to work independently, prioritize work, perform maintenance procedures on buildings and grounds, understand and correctly apply cleaning and maintenance standards, safely operate and maintain manual and powered cleaning and grounds equipment.

To be successful in this position, you must have a valid Fireman's Certification and Refrigeration Operators Certificate or a 5th Class Engineers Certification as well as several years of related experience. Through this experience, you will have comprehensive knowledge of building heating, cooling and ventilation systems, DDC control systems, extensive knowledge of cleaning techniques and procedures, thorough working knowledge of the WHMIS program and superior interpersonal/public relations skills. Experience working with computer software applications including Microsoft (Outlook and Word) and Archibus is required as well as a valid driver's licence.
